Why not center on a stud, drill new holes in center
of bracket run bolts thru new holes and use 6
Hilti togglers on orginal 6 mounting holes.
Not a great idea, Mark. Think about what happens to the loading if the plasma is out from the wall and angled across the room. The single stud you've mounted the assembly to is now being torqued in an S, as well as being pulled out from the wall. Drywall screw pops will be the first sign of impending plasma doom.
